A Super-Targeted Prize and Strategic Email Marketing Spelled Success for Ski Utah’s Second Sweepstakes

Strategy: Ski Utah, based in Salt Lake City, Utah, represents 15 ski resorts and over 250 corporate partners and sponsors with the common goal of encouraging the world to ski in Utah. Their program, Discover Winter, focuses on expanding the sport by introducing ethnically diverse and LGBTQ+ individuals to skiing/riding through a series of lessons. In 2022, they successfully raised $60,325 for Discover Winter by choosing a highly desirable prize, and then promoting it to the right group of people via email. In 2023, they capitalized on their previous success, running “the greatest sweepstakes you've laid your eyes on” and surpassing their first sweepstakes, raising $82,075.

Story: Ski Utah knows their base like the back of their hand! Made up of dedicated skiers and snowboarders, Ski Utah’s donors showed up to support the nonprofit in 2022 when they ran a sweepstakes for two Ski Utah Gold Passes. Valued at $6,500 each, Gold Passes are a snow sport enthusiast’s dream come true: they offer access to all 15 Utah ski resorts with no blackout dates, unlimited skiing (and hiking during the summer), and more. Plus, Ski Utah threw in two days of heli skiing for their die-hard ski fans! 

In 2023, the organization wanted to build on their success and create an even more irresistible sweepstakes to entice their donors to come back for more. In addition to the two Gold Passes, which this year featured no blackout dates, were fully transferable, and valued at $20,000, Ski Utah also included a private dinner for up to 24 guests at Solitude’s Yurt, a $2,500 gift certificate toward ski or snowboard purchases, two Stio Environ outerwear kits, and two Gregory Verte 18L packs, two Gregory Targhee 32 packs, and two Gregory Alpaca 60 duffel bags.

Phew! That’s quite a prize package that expertly appealed to their donor base, putting Ski Utah in a wonderful position to raise quite a lot of money on their sweepstakes. They did a great job working with sponsors and partners to create the prize package, and it paid off.

Ski Utah was strategic in keeping their base updated about the sweepstakes by sending out an email when the sweepstakes launched, then on a planned schedule through the duration of the sweepstakes, and more frequently as the sweepstakes came to a close. Each time they sent an email blast, they included a unique promo code that helped them track the success of that particular email.
